About This Book

In an era where digital threats evolve daily, understanding cybersecurity fundamentals has become as essential as locking your front door. "Cyber Security Basics" addresses the critical gap between recognizing online dangers and implementing effective protective measures, offering readers a comprehensive framework for digital safety. The book examines three primary areas: threat identification, prevention strategies, and response protocols. These interconnected topics form the foundation of personal and professional digital security, particularly relevant as global cybercrime damages are projected to reach $10.5 trillion annually by 2025. Beginning with a historical overview of cyber threats since the 1980s, the text establishes crucial context for understanding current digital vulnerabilities. Readers need only basic computer literacy to grasp the concepts, as technical terms are clearly defined and explained throughout the work. The central thesis maintains that effective cybersecurity requires a proactive, layered approach combining technical tools, human awareness, and systematic protocols. This argument is developed through practical examples and real-world case studies, demonstrating how seemingly minor security oversights can lead to significant breaches. The book's structure progresses logically through risk assessment, security implementation, and incident response. Key chapters cover social engineering tactics, password security protocols, encryption basics, and network protection strategies. The material culminates in a practical framework for creating personalized security plans for both individuals and small organizations. Supporting evidence includes data from recent cyber attacks, analysis of breach patterns, and insights from cybersecurity professionals. The book incorporates findings from government security agencies, independent research institutions, and private sector security firms. The content connects cybersecurity to psychology, examining how human behavior influences digital vulnerability. It also explores links with economics and law, discussing both the financial impact of breaches and the evolving legal framework around digital security.
